What is the Remainderman?
A remainderman is a legal term referring to an individual or entity that holds a remainder interest in a property. This means that the remainderman will receive ownership of the property after a particular event occurs, typically the death of the current owner, known as the life tenant. The life tenant has the right to use the property during their lifetime, while the remainderman's interest is contingent upon the life tenant's passing.
This arrangement is common in estate planning, allowing property owners to designate how their assets will be distributed after their death. Understanding the role of a remainderman is crucial for anyone involved in estate planning or property management.

Legal Use of the Remainderman
The legal use of a remainderman interest is governed by state laws and regulations. It is essential to ensure that the arrangement complies with these laws to avoid disputes or challenges after the life tenant's death. Properly executed wills and trusts that include a remainderman can provide clarity and prevent potential conflicts among heirs.
Additionally, the remainderman should be aware of their rights and responsibilities regarding the property. This includes understanding that they cannot interfere with the life tenant's use of the property until the life tenant passes away.

Eligibility Criteria
Eligibility to designate a remainderman typically requires that the property owner is of legal age and has the mental capacity to make decisions regarding their estate. Additionally, the remainderman must be a legal entity or individual capable of holding property, which may include family members, friends, or charitable organizations.
It is advisable for property owners to consult with legal professionals to ensure that their choices comply with applicable laws and that the intended arrangement is valid.
